CINCINNATI (WXIX) – After a hot and humid day, strong storms are rolling into the Tri-State this evening. Damaging wind and small hail will be the biggest concern with the stronger cells along with intense downpours and frequent lightning. Best chances for storms tonight will continue through 10pm tonight.
A few storms may linger overnight into early Wednesday morning, but most of the area will dry out quickly. Behind the front, highs will only reach the low 80s Wednesday with breezy north winds helping to drop humidity levels. Skies will gradually clear by late in the day, setting up a more comfortable second half of the work week.
Thursday and Friday both look pleasant, with highs in the low to mid 80s and much drier air in place. Sunshine will mix with some passing clouds, and overnight lows will dip into the mid 60s. Patchy fog is possible both mornings in low-lying areas, but otherwise the end of the week shapes up nicely…
